It was a good run, but Ashdown unfortunately witnessed the end of their four-game winning streak on Tuesday. They fell just short of the Atlanta Rabbits by a score of 6-5.
Riley Williamson was huge no matter where he played even without the win. On the mound, he didn't allow a single earned run while striking out 11 over 6.2 innings pitched. What's more, he gave up only two walks, the fewest he's had since back in March. He was also solid in the batter's box, scoring a run while going 2-for-3.
Williamson wasn't the only one making solid contact as three players wound up with at least one hit. One of them was Gunnar Altenbaumer, who scored a run while getting on base in three of his four plate appearances. Kutter Dollarhide was another, going 1-for-3 with two RBI.
Ashdown's loss dropped their record down to 15-8. As for Atlanta, they are on a roll lately: they've won six of their last seven games. That's provided a nice bump to their 14-7-1 record this season.
Ashdown and Atlanta should be looking forward to their upcoming games as both have a sizable advantage in their respective state rankings. Ashdown will challenge Fouke at 5:00 p.m. on Friday with a big rank advantage (25 vs. 93). Meanwhile, Atlanta (ranked 249th) will meet New Boston (ranked 1118th) at 7:00 p.m. on Friday.
